    They are very fun snakes, I wouldn't consider them "big" though ;-) My girl is about 2.5 yrs old now, and only a little over 5 ft or so, and quite slender... When all coiled, she looks quite small. She's been a slow grower though, just recently starting to put on good, noticeable size.

    Here's the oldest shot I have of her, the day I brought her home, she was about 1 year old at the time...

    http://i286.photobucket.com/albums/l...ummer08026.jpg

    Her colors were pretty decent then, just much duller, but over the last 10 months or so, she's really turned out phenomenal. I had a neonate pic from her breeder a while back, but don't know what happened to it... She was born as a dark brown/tan baby, started coloring up satin black/bright yellow from the head down, and is now pretty much a "picture perfect" jungle :D
